Triston Harper has had a whirlwind year to say the least. Since finishing in the top five of American Idol‘s 22nd season, the teen hasn’t had a spare moment.
Fans fell for Harper’s country twang when he auditioned for Idol when he was just 15. More than that, though, Harper pulled out viewers’ heartstrings with his life story.

While auditioning for the show, Harper revealed that, after experiencing abuse at the hands of his stepfather, he and his mom wound up homeless. He was 12 at the time.
“It makes me happy just thinking about it,” Harper said of being able to share his story with American Idol viewers.
Eventually, he made his way to Idol, where he performed tracks including “God’s Country,” “Heartbreak Hotel,” and “Sand in My Boots.” He was eliminated after making it the top five, and Abi Carter went on to win the season.
Triston Harper’s Life After American Idol
After his stint on Idol, Harper released a single called “H.O.P.E.” He performed at CMA Fest, released a track titled “Wrapped Up in Jesus,” and teased other music on the way.
Perhaps the biggest update, however, came in Harper’s personal life. The singer, who’s now 16, revealed in November that he married his girlfriend, Paris Reed. Shortly thereafter, Harper announced that he and Reed are expecting their first child.
“I just felt my baby kick for the first time and I can’t even express in words the way it has made me feel,” he wrote on Facebook in February. “Everyday that I wake up I look over to my wife and I think to myself how did I get so lucky to have a wife that is beautiful on the inside as well as the outside.”
“My wife is carrying my baby and taking every step that I take, making sacrifices, riding in a vehicle for hours and hours and helping my mama sell merchandise and look for venues for me to perform,” he added. “I may not have a mansion, nor a 100 acres of land but I am content.”
